Understanding Key Fob Programming
Key fob programming describes the process of configuring a key fob so it can communicate efficiently with a vehicle's computer system. The majority of modern-day cars make use of key fobs as part of their security systems, and reprogramming might be necessary if:
The key fob's battery is dead.The key fob has been lost or harmed.The vehicle's computer system has been reset.
While some key fob concerns can be dealt with by simply replacing the battery, others need expert intervention. Below are several avenues vehicle owners can explore.
1. Car Dealerships
Utilizing a car dealership is frequently the most straightforward technique for getting a key fob programmed. Dealerships have the necessary customized devices and software application to program key fobs for particular lorries.

Automotive Locksmiths
Automotive locksmith professionals are another reliable option for key fob programming. They possess the essential tools and training to program a vast array of key fobs, often at a reduced cost compared to dealerships.

The cost to program a key fob can vary from ₤ 20 to ₤ 300, depending on the method utilized and whether the key fob is original or aftermarket.
Q2: How long does it require to program a key fob?
Programming a key fob can take anywhere from a few minutes to a couple of hours. Dealers might take longer due to additional procedures.
Q3: Can I program my own key fob?
Sometimes, yes. Older vehicles and particular brand names offer fundamental programming methods that owners can carry out. Describe the vehicle's user handbook for specific guidelines.
Q4: What should I do if my key fob still doesn't work after programming?
If a key fob fails to operate even after programming, have it inspected by an expert to determine if the problem lies with the fob itself or the vehicle's receiver.
Q5: Are aftermarket key fobs dependable?
While aftermarket key fobs may be less costly, there's often less dependability compared to OEM items. Always store from reputable sellers if opting for an aftermarket choice.
